Southern Pacific Depot, 21 East Millbrae Avenue, Millbrae, San Mateo County, CA

description

Summary

Significance: Frame with clapboarding, 65' x 50', two stories with one-story wings, hip roofs with wooden shingles, bracketed eaves, overhanging roof on first-story level supported by columns on E elevation; waiting room, office, baggage room, ticket office on first floor, station-master's quarters on second floor. Built 1907 from Southern Pacific stock design; overhanging roofed area on S elevation removed; relocated 1979.

Survey number: HABS CA-2059

Building/structure dates: 1907 Initial Construction

Building/structure dates: 1979
